CI note — Ledgermill partition migration. Nightly job fails when the month-boundary partition for the orders table isn't pre-created; the Tallyfork loader then writes to the default partition and the integrity check aborts. Fix: run the partition bootstrap step before the loader, not after. Added a guard so the pipeline fails fast with a clear message instead of halfway through. Safe to re-trigger once the bootstrap is confirmed. The failing run's trace token is below.

pipeline stamp: htk3_69f

## Capacity Note: SQL Lint Fleet

The Quarrel linter now runs on every commit touching .sql files in the Dovestone monorepo. Rule evaluation is CPU-bound; the heavy formatters dominate runtime, so we shard files across workers and cap per-file analysis time. At current commit volume we have roughly 2x headroom, but the planned migration of the Harkness warehouse repos will consume most of it. We'll revisit worker counts next quarter. The limits currently in effect are defined below.

tuning table, yajog-yahof:
BUDGETS = {
    "lamvan": 303,
    "wenox": 460,
    "fenvan": 525,
}

## Deployment

ReceiptWren, our donation-receipt mailer, deploys from the `stable` branch via the Quillgate pipeline. Before promoting a build, confirm the template bundle version matches what the Harbrook finance team signed off on, since receipts are legally sensitive. Run the dry-run mailer against the sandbox donor list and inspect at least three rendered PDFs. Rollbacks must restore both the binary and the template bundle together; mismatched pairs produce blank totals. The environment expects the following configuration values at startup.

settings of tawif-tafog:
[oliox]
port = 7000
team = pelius
host = oliox.plorvaforge.corp
region = upper-2
access_code = ac_48b9f0
timeout_ms = 3000

## Action Item: FD Leak Guardrails

Following the Lanterbee incident, plugins loaded into the Corvass host must respect per-plugin file-descriptor budgets. The host now samples open descriptors and evicts plugins that exceed their allotment twice within a sampling window. Budgets are generous but enforced without appeal. The enforcement thresholds the host applies to all third-party plugins are listed below.

tuning table, fawef-yafog:
CAPS = {
    "quenvan": 921,
    "gilael": 772,
    "holath": 589,
    "tamvan": 76,
    "eliys": 721,
}